"A Documentary History of Dinnington" by Gerald H. Stratford, 1992. (written by a genealogist for genealogists)
This previously unpublished book contains as you would expect, a history of Dinnington and the immediately surrounding area written with genealogists in mind. Dealing in the main with people, it contains many hundreds of names in such items as the graveyard monumental inscriptions, censuses, wills, etc. The pages of the book are typewritten, and unfortunately volume IV is in a script which makes it non-machine readable and consequently non-machine searchable. The remaing volumes are fully searchable.
